["In a food processor blend together almonds and oats until they resemble fine crumbs. Add in dates, peanut butter, and vanilla.", "Pulse until everything comes together. The mixture may look crumbly, but just make sure you can form it into a ""cookie""; if not, add a little more peanut butter to make sure everything will come together.", "Once you get the consistency you want, form dough into cookies using your hands. This may take a few times pressing the dough together and working it into the size and shape you want.", "Once formed into cookies, take a fork and press down to give yourself the classic peanut butter imprint.", "Store in the fridge for up to 5 days. Enjoy!"]
